174 * Afs command handlers run as a process which is not related to the afs
175 * process, i.e. they can not change the address space of afs directly.
176 * Therefore afs commands typically consist of two functions: The command
177 * handler and the corresponding callback function that runs in afs context.
179 * \sa send_callback_request().
181 typedef void callback_function(int fd, const struct osl_object *);
184 * Callbacks send chunks to data back to the command handler. Pointers to
185 * this type of function are used by \ref send_callback_request and friends
186 * to deal with the data in the command handler process.
188 * \sa \ref send_callback_request().
190 typedef int callback_result_handler(struct osl_object *result, void *private);
